Felix Barrett, founder and artistic director of Punchdrunk, tells Anna James how the pioneering company always seeks to transcend theatrical experience, why he resists the label ‘immersive’ and how the form-smashing TV crossover project The Third Day – in development for nine years – was salvaged after Covid-19 hit
